    2 Product 2.1 General Welding machine is a rectifier adopting the most advanced inverter technology. The development of welding equipment benefits from the appearance of the inverter power supply theory and components. The principle is to commutate the power frequency of 50Hz/60Hz into direct current, and then utilize the high-power single tube IGBT to invert it into high frequency (15K/16K), then reduce the voltage and commutate, and output high-power D.C power supply via Pulse Width Modulation (PWM).

  • Page 16 ⚫ Start to welding The machine has the ways of HF to start arc. HF: Keep 2-4mm space between tungsten pole and work piece, press torch switch, the machine start to work after the pre gas time. When stop welding and the electric arc stick out, keep the welding position for a while so that the weld spot could be protected before cooling down for delaying argon.

    4.3 Welding Environment and Safety Environment ⚫ The machine can perform in environment where conditions are dry with a dampness level of max 90%. Ambient temperature is between -10 to 40 degrees centigrade. Avoid welding in sunshine or drippings. Do not let water enter the gas Avoid welding in dust area or the environment with corrosive gas.

    5 Daily Maintenance and Checking ⚫ Daily maintenance Remove dust regularly with dry compressed air. If the welding machine is used in surroundings with heavy smoke and polluted air, it is necessary to remove dust at least one time one month. The pressure of compressed air shall fall to required level to prevent damage to small components in the machine.
